FORT WORTH - TCU's No. 52-ranked women's tennis team travels to Dallas on Wednesday for a 6 p.m., match with No. 29 SMU at the Turpin Tennis Stadium.
The Horned Frogs are 1-2 this season, with both of their losses coming to ranked opponents. Most recently, TCU dropped a 6-1 decision to Texas A&M on Feb. 12. Wednesday's match will be the second night match of the season for TCU, which also played under the lights at the ITA Kickoff Weekend on Jan. 28.
The Mustangs are 8-2 this season and are riding a three-match winning streak into Wednesday's match. SMU downed UT-Pan American, 7-0, on Jan. 21, a day before TCU beat UTPA by the same score.
TCU's No. 1 doubles team of Federica Denti and Katariina Tuohimaa is 3-0 this spring and 8-2 overall including fall results since becoming doubles partners during the ITA Regional Championships in October.
The Frog tandem will get an opportunity to avenge one of its losses Wednesday, when they square off with SMU's No. 34-ranked doubles team of Marta Lesniak and Heather Steinbauer.
Gaby Mastromarino is 3-0 this season for the Frogs in singles, playing two matches at the No. 6 slot and one at the No. 5 slot. She picked up the lone point for TCU in its last match against Texas A&M.
Aside from being ranked in doubles, SMU's Lesniak is also the fifth-ranked doubles player in the Campbell's/ITA College Tennis Rankings. She boasts a 25-5 record overall, including a 7-2 mark this spring.
In the all-time series between the two schools, TCU holds a 26-18 advantage. SMU was a 7-0 winner in last year's meeting in Fort Worth.
